| 60 | Repair of cracks: Repairing of cracks by cutting v-u shaped grove of 25 mm in which and 15 mm in depth along the crack, cleaning the surface removing dust. Applying single coat of La Flex Coat modified cementitious coating prepared by mixing La Flex Coat, water and cement in the ratio 1:1:2 vol/vol by a brush on the groove as an bonding coat. - (Rendering the groove with 1:4 Polymer modified mortar admixed with 5% La Flex Coat by the weight of cement on the above coat while it is still wet. The surface to be finished smooth maintaining level with adjacent area) - (Rate taken from Company including 10% contractor profit) |
| 61 | WATER PROOFING COURSE : Applying first coat of La AcryDec on primed surface @400 gms per Sq.m while the coat is still tacky lay a Glass Fibre reinforced borosilicate glass fibre Cloth dipped in La Flex Coat Solution prepared by mixing La Flex Coat and water in the ratio if 1:3 v/v. Care should be taken to avoid any wraping of the Glass Fibre cloth. Applying second coat La AcryDec on the Glass Fibre cloth @400 gms per Sq.m by a brush after 6 hrs. and continuted to the height of 150 mm along the parapet wall. - (Rate taken from Company including 10% contractor profit) |
